Was there a blizzard in 2016?
A slow moving powerful winter storm pounded the Mid-Atlantic for consecutive days from January 22-24. Covering an area from Arkansas to Massachusetts more than 100 million people were affected by the storm.

What was the winter of 2016 like?
Winter 2016-17 was much warmer and wetter than average for parts of the United States according to preliminary data compiled by the Southeast Regional Climate Center. One region however saw much colder temperatures than average while a few areas reported one of the coldest winters on record.
What year had the most snow?
The heaviest annual snowfall ever measured in the entire United States and the world is 95 feet (29 metres) that fell between July 1 1998 and June 30 1999 at the downhill ski area on Mount Baker Washington.
What is the most snow Maryland has gotten?
The most snowfall ever recorded in a single winter in Maryland was during the winter of 2009-10 when 262.5 inches of snow fell at Keysers Ridge in Garrett County.

What is the snowiest place on Earth?
Aomori City
The snowiest city in the world with an average of 26 feet — or eight meters — of snowfall every year is Aomori City in Aomori Prefecture Japan. For comparison the average snowfall in Sapporo Japan — which comes in at number two on the list of snowiest cities — is 16 feet or almost 5 meters.Jan 9 2019

What month does Maryland get the most snow?
The first snowfall of winter for Baltimore usually arrives in December. Although uncommon November can get a little snow. The season’s last snowfall typically happens in March. Once every three or four years Baltimore’s last snowfall occurs as early as February.

What year did it snow in July?
The Year Without a Summer
The dust from the 1815 eruption of Mount Tambora in the Dutch East Indies (now Indonesia) caused a worldwide lowering of temperatures during the summer of 1816 when the Almanac legend has it inadvertently but correctly predicted snow for July.
Has there ever been snow in April?
For most of the contiguous United States April snowfall may be quite rare but April is actually the snowiest month of the year for some isolated locations in the Rocky Mountains and the Black Hills of South Dakota.

What is a snow tornado called?
Thundersnow also known as a winter thunderstorm or a thundersnowstorm is an unusual kind of thunderstorm with snow falling as the primary precipitation instead of rain.
